- Support in domestic and international travel arrangements (hotel booking, transportation arrangement, ticketing etc) for non-research staff and visitors in/out of Vietnam;
- Assist in verification of monthly travel consolidated reports provided by authorized travel agents and ensure accuracy and completeness;
- Support in sourcing potential vendors, obtain quotations for products and services;
- Support in creating products and suppliers ID in OCS system;
- Assist in obtaining key contracting information, drafting commercial contracts and Professional Services Agreement (PSA) for review;
- Receive purchase order delivery and collect the supporting documents from suppliers/vendors for project requests;
- Assist in raising purchase requisition and follow up on orders to ensure on time delivery;
- Ensure the procurement process is in compliance with Alliance’s Procurement Policies and procedures;
- Back-up to receive purchase order delivery and collect the supporting documents from suppliers/vendors for Vietnam office supplies and services;
- Assist in drafting the invitation letters and certificates of employment for visa applications (in/out of Vietnam);
- Support in maintaining the list of assets and inventories for Vietnam operations;
- Assist in drafting letter to AGI for permission vehicle parking/entry and onboard staff picture at the main lobby;
- Assist with logistic arrangements for internal events;
- Support the proper filing, effective archiving, upkeep of documentation through photocopy, scan and filing documents;
- Other tasks as assigned by the supervisor.
